LOOS is a generative expert system for the design of two-dimensional layouts of rectangles that can be adapted to different domains. The system is able to systematically enumerate alternative solutions with interesting trade-offs, taking into account a broad spectrum of criteria and practical concerns. The paper describes the overall architecture of the system, in which domain knowledge is incorporated as test rules, and adaptations to two domains, the remodelling of residential kitchens and the layout of service cores for high-rise office buildings. It argues that domain knowledge is particularly easy to elicit, represent and use in this form and indicates directions for further research based on the experience gained in the two domains. © 1990.
